The NBA season, typically running from October to June, features a regular season, playoffs, and the NBA Finals. Each stage has its own schedule, and games can be played any day of the week, often multiple times a day to accommodate different time zones. This is where the challenge begins for Filipino fans, as most games are played during North American prime time, which translates to late nights or early mornings in the Philippines. To effectively follow the NBA, you need to know how to convert Eastern Time (ET), the standard time zone used by the NBA, to PHT. Eastern Time is 12 hours behind Philippine Time. For example, a game scheduled for 8:00 PM ET is 8:00 AM the next day in the Philippines. Keeping this conversion in mind will help you avoid missing the start of any game. How to Stream NBA Games Live in the Philippines
Okay, so you've got the schedule down, but how do you actually watch the games live here in the Philippines? Let’s explore the best streaming options. NBA League Pass is the premier streaming service for NBA games. It offers live and on-demand access to every NBA game, including playoffs and finals. NBA League Pass allows you to watch games on multiple devices, including computers, smartphones, tablets, and smart TVs. It also provides various subscription options, including single-game passes, monthly subscriptions, and full-season packages, catering to different viewing preferences. Cignal TV is a popular satellite TV provider in the Philippines that offers NBA TV as part of its sports packages. NBA TV broadcasts live games, replays, and NBA-related programming 24/7. Subscribing to Cignal TV with the NBA TV add-on is a convenient way to watch NBA games on your television. Another option is to use international streaming services that carry NBA games, such as YouTube TV, Sling TV, and Hulu + Live TV. However, these services may require a VPN (Virtual Private Network) to access from the Philippines due to geo-restrictions. A VPN allows you to mask your IP address and appear as if you are accessing the internet from another country, enabling you to bypass these restrictions.
